Output 1363cabf071ef200c9348838994dd90c4ccf83a611c8e9b21e119611b5e9c10f:1

value
3016590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d28bbe7bc15c3bd222aa8211a9ef4470faa1442f OP_EQUAL
address
3LtHER8DA9DMP6R2EtaN38AfSjQUh8FBYY
transaction
1363cabf071ef200c9348838994dd90c4ccf83a611c8e9b21e119611b5e9c10f
spent
true